WebHallo is a common way to begin German email greetings when you’re taking a more casual tone. Meaning “hello”, this can be used for both male and female addressees in an informal letter or email. Liebe…, This is the most common opening for a German email or letter. It is the equivalent of "dear" in English.
Web27 aug. 2024 · When you are in Austria you will most often hear “Wie hat’s di” as a way of saying “How are you” in German. In Switzerland you have a variety of fun option such as “Wie gaht’s”, “Wie gohts” or “Wiä häsches”. Pick the one that is easiest to pronounce for you and run with it.
